Updater problems (no packages found)
If, when running the updater, you only see two lines:

Getting package listing
Done!
This implies that your license key is not correctly registered, or there is a problem on the update server regarding your license. When entering your license, please make sure it is correctly entered, including uppercase characters and dashes.

You can, at this time, confirm your license key by doing the following:

1. Open the start menu, select run (Windows XP) or start search (Windows Vista)
2. Enter the command "regedit" and press enter
3. On the left side of the Registry Editor window navigate to: "My Computer\H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Fantasy Grounds\2.0"
4. On the right side, you should see a list of values including one named "LicenseKey".
5. Check that the value matches your license.
6. If the value does not match, double click on the value name, and enter your license key with dashes in the "Value data" edit box that appears. Click OK.
7. Close the Registry Editor.


If you need further assistance with the procedure, or if the problem still presists, please contact [email protected] by e-mail, as we will need to check your license details for any possible errors on the update server. Please include the original e-mail address used to purchase the license, if possible.
